Danfoss Power Solutions II LLC files annual Form R disclosures to the EPA Toxics Release Inventory under EPCRA Section 313, classified under NAICS 326220 (Plastics and Rubber). Across 5 years of records spanning 2019–2023, the site has disclosed 17.2K lbs in cumulative toxic releases across 5 distinct chemicals, 1 of which (20%) carry a carcinogenic classification.

The dominant release pathway is off-site transfers at 16.2K lbs (94.4% of total volume), followed by air releases at 5.6%. Between 2019 and 2023, reported totals decreased by 84% - from 4.5K lbs to 709 lbs. The facility is operated under parent company Danfoss Power Solutions (us) Co.

TRI Form R values are self-reported estimates, not measured stack emissions, and treat every pound of reported chemical equally regardless of toxicity. Inclusion in the TRI database does not establish a health risk to nearby residents; it documents the annual reporting record that Danfoss Power Solutions II LLC has filed with the EPA under federal community right-to-know requirements.

Data comes from the EPA Toxic Release Inventory (TRI) program. Facilities that manufacture, process, or otherwise use listed toxic chemicals above threshold amounts are required to report annually to the EPA.

Release quantities are self-reported by the facility and may represent estimates rather than exact measurements. "Total releases" includes releases to air, water, land, and off-site transfers for disposal. Quantities shown here are aggregated across all available reporting years.
